About the Role
Our client is developing and commercializing a modular nanogrid system and is seeking a Manufacturing / Production Engineer to strengthen production processes, manage build readiness, support inventory planning, and ensure timely manufacturing and installation of customer systems. This role is crucial for a growing hardware company focused on production quality, inventory accuracy, supplier lead times, and customer installation schedules.
Responsibilities
- Develop, improve, and maintain production processes for product assembly, testing, shipment, and installation readiness.
- Translate engineering designs into clear, repeatable production workflows.
- Create and maintain work instructions, assembly procedures, checklists, quality-control documents, and production travelers.
- Work with engineering and technicians to identify and resolve assembly, wiring, mechanical, documentation, and process issues.
- Support production planning by defining labor requirements, tooling needs, workstation setup, material flow, and assembly sequencing.
- Review bills of materials, drawings, production documentation, and customer-specific configuration details for accuracy and completeness.
- Ensure production builds match the approved engineering design, customer requirements, and installation scope.
- Identify opportunities to reduce errors, improve efficiency, shorten build time, and increase production consistency.
- Support incoming inspection, in-process inspection, final inspection, and test-readiness processes.
- Help create root-cause analysis and corrective-action processes for production or quality issues.
- Collaborate with engineering on design-for-manufacturing, design-for-service, and design-for-installation improvements.
- Support production readiness for new product revisions, customer-specific configurations, and field upgrades.
- Work with TUV or similar agencies to meet applicable UL certification or ISO compliance requirements.
- Maintain accurate visibility into current inventory, including stock, location, and allocation.
- Determine required parts for upcoming system builds, installations, upgrades, and service work.
- Compare upcoming build requirements against available inventory and identify shortages.
- Track inbound parts, open purchase orders, expected arrival dates, supplier commitments, and delivery delays.
- Maintain or improve inventory tracking systems, part lists, BOMs, reorder points, and build-specific materials checklists.
- Define minimum stock levels, safety stock requirements, reorder points, and preferred stocking strategies.
- Track supplier lead times, minimum order quantities, pricing, and ordering constraints.
- Ensure material availability is reviewed early and continuously to support production and installation schedules.
- Determine when purchase orders need to be placed for timely part arrival.
- Develop forward-looking materials plans based on production schedule, customer projects, supplier lead times, and installation commitments.
- Communicate material risks clearly to leadership, engineering, production, and operations.
- Support vendor coordination, supplier follow-up, and escalation for delayed critical parts.
- Identify opportunities to qualify alternate suppliers or substitute parts in coordination with engineering.
- Help reduce emergency purchasing, expedited shipping, stockouts, and schedule disruptions.
- Support continuous improvement of purchasing, receiving, inventory, and production-readiness processes.
